Natural Stone
Marble and Granite especially are very popular stones for counter tops. For people who like a natural stone look with unique and unexpected shapes and patterns, these tend to be the best options. Depending on the natural patterns of the cut stone, they range from bold and large patterns to milky splashes on a dark background; others have bright colours, reminiscent of a peacock’s tail. Shiny blue, gold, silver, bronze, and green are common and appear standalone or mixed together. More expensive stones of this variety come with visible, authentic shell and fish fossils! Natural stones can be installed in any style of kitchen (classic, modern etc.). Natural stones are preferred for classic and detailed kitchens. Maintenance and cleaning are very simple as long as you don’t use harsh cleansers and abrasive sponges – use a premium cleanser for cleaning. Manmade Stones
Manmade stones come in many solid and patterned colours, with or without sparkles. The finishing is very smooth and fewer pores keep these stones from staining. Maintenance is easier than with granite and there are more organized patterns and designs with quartz. Quartz is best for transitional (mostly off white kitchens) and also used in modern kitchen. As with any kind of stone top, an under mounted sink could be installed.
Stainless Steel, Glass and Solid Wood Tops
These types of tops are also very good looking and each one gives the project a different impression. Stainless steel and glass are mostly used for areas desired to have a commercial look (bars, restaurants and coffee shops) but are in high demand for home areas as well. Stainless steel is scratched easily but after a while your eyes get used to it. Although stainless steel loses its initial shininess, it is a durable and timeless material. Wood tops are usually seen in serving areas – and are usually not used in kitchens or anywhere near where food is prepared.
